Output 64bb1660ec35e922a9591eaf2d02a9b651e381660d31d7b0ae3e79c9d30c4e80:0

value
2086543
script pubkey
OP_0 OP_PUSHBYTES_20 6e905ad1a22e6aadca7e860615d3826ce8d43efc
address
bc1qd6g945dz9e42mjn7scrpt5uzdn5dg0huyeunu6
transaction
64bb1660ec35e922a9591eaf2d02a9b651e381660d31d7b0ae3e79c9d30c4e80
spent
true